Berry provides an AI-powered creative platform that helps brands maintain consistency across marketing outputs. The platform uses a Brand Memory system to encode visual and stylistic rules, enabling automated generation of images, ads, and videos. It is designed for e-commerce businesses and digital sellers to scale creative production without large design teams.

Dentsu is a global advertising agency with over 66,000 professionals across 143 markets. It serves 85 of the top 100 advertisers worldwide. The agency provides integrated marketing and advertising solutions leveraging consumer intelligence.
